Simatic Ipc547E - Industrial Panel PCs For Harsh Environments

What is a SIMATIC IPC547E?

The SIMATIC IPC547E is a robust industrial panel PC from Siemens, designed for demanding automation and control applications. It is part of the SIMATIC IPC (Industrial Personal Computer) family, known for its high reliability, long-term availability, and rugged construction suitable for harsh industrial environments. These systems typically feature a fanless design, wide operating temperature ranges, and certifications for shock and vibration resistance, making them ideal for factory floors, process control rooms, and other challenging settings.

Key Specifications and Technical Details

While specific configurations vary, a typical SIMATIC IPC547E features a high-performance Intel Core i processor (e.g., i5 or i7), ample DDR4 RAM, and solid-state storage for reliability. Its defining characteristics are its industrial-grade components and design:

  • Rugged Enclosure: Built to withstand dust, moisture, and physical impacts, often with an IP65-rated front panel.

  • Fanless Operation: Eliminates moving parts for higher reliability and silent performance, preventing dust ingress.

  • Wide Operating Range: Functions reliably in extended temperature ranges, often from 0°C to 50°C or wider.

  • Industrial Connectivity: Includes multiple Ethernet ports (often with PROFINET support), serial ports (RS-232/485), and USB ports for connecting to PLCs, HMIs, and other industrial equipment.

  • Certifications: Compliant with industrial standards for electromagnetic compatibility (EMC), shock, and vibration.

Applications and Use Cases

The SIMATIC IPC547E is engineered for mission-critical industrial computing tasks. Common applications include:

  • Machine Control & HMI: Serving as the central operator interface and control unit for complex machinery.

  • Process Visualization: Displaying real-time data from SCADA (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ition) systems in manufacturing, chemical, or pharmaceutical plants.

  • Data Acquisition & Monitoring: Collecting and processing sensor data on the production line.

  • Test Benches & Quality Control: Running specialized software for product testing and inspection.

Comparison: Industrial vs. Commercial Panel PCs

Feature Industrial Panel PC (e.g., SIMATIC IPC547E) Commercial Panel PC / Touchscreen Monitor
Operating Environment Harsh (dust, moisture, wide temps, vibration) Office/Controlled (clean, stable temperature)
Reliability & Lifespan High; designed for 24/7 operation, long-term availability Standard; not optimized for continuous industrial use
Design Fanless, rugged metal chassis, sealed front (IP65 common) Often includes fans for cooling, less robust construction
Connectivity Industrial ports (PROFINET, serial, isolated DI/DO) Standard ports (USB, HDMI, Ethernet)
Certifications UL, CE, EMC, vibration/shock resistant Basic safety certifications (CE, FCC)
Total Cost of Ownership Higher initial cost, lower long-term maintenance Lower initial cost, potential for higher downtime
